Remembering Brad Edwards

The staff and friends of Yellowstone Public Radio celebrate the life of Brad Edwards, who passed away recently in Billings. Brad’s talent as a percussionist was heard in venues big and small across the region, and indeed, throughout the world, in a career that included tours and gigs with some of the most legendary names in jazz.

For three decades beginning the mid 1980s, Brad’s Afternoon Jazz was also heard every weekday afternoon, first on KEMC in Billings and then across the region as the station’s reach grew to become Yellowstone Public Radio. For all of those years, Brad’s eclectic ear and extensive knowledge provided listeners with a first-rate education in—and appreciation of—jazz in all its forms.

We celebrate Brad’s artistry, his great stories, and his tireless advocacy of jazz music and education. The staff and friends of Yellowstone Public Radio extend our condolences to all who knew Brad and are suffering his loss.
